Rewiring glucose metabolism improves 5-FU efficacy in glycolytic p53-deficient colorectal tumors

2021-11-16

Abstract excerpt

5-fluorouracil (5-FU) is the backbone for chemotherapy in colorectal cancer (CRC). Response rates in patients are, however, limited to 50%. Despite the importance of 5-FU, the molecular mechanisms by which it induces toxicity remain unclear, limiting the development of strategies to improve efficacy.
